Output 7ef509bb46e836049625702c19bbba32146bcf9b356dfb2434e8fcf1055c1c70:1

value
8752236
script pubkey
OP_0 OP_PUSHBYTES_20 e97d4f46278b6d42b5a12ebbb2f6816ff8c18ddc
address
bc1qa97573383dk59ddp96am9a5pdluvrrwu6mptsa
transaction
7ef509bb46e836049625702c19bbba32146bcf9b356dfb2434e8fcf1055c1c70
confirmations
138597
spent
true